Hi there

Recently i put win 2000 on my P2 266mhz PC, however now i have to re-install all the drivers, including the modem. However the only problem i have is that i dont know what the make or type of modem it is to install the driver for it - is there any way of finding out the type of modem as at the moment i cannot dial up to anything,

Take out the modem and search for a driver with information found on the modem, modems are the only devices that you cant rely on third party software as even the same model but modified by different manufactures could required its own unique driver.

If there is nothing on the modem download aida32, it should tell you.

Van Nugent
Nov 10, 2003, 03:43 PM
Do as Duffy suggested. AIDA32 can only identify the hardware when the system does recognize them.
